Neighborhood Overview

The Blue Ridge Sportsman Club is situated in a serene, semi-rural setting north of downtown Harrisburg, offering a quiet environment conducive to focused sport and recreation. Access to the facility is primarily via local roads that connect quickly to the major regional arteries, including Interstate 81 and Route 22. Visitors arriving by air will typically fly into Harrisburg International Airport, which is approximately a 25 to 30-minute drive from the club depending on traffic conditions. The site features dedicated parking areas designed to accommodate members and guests, though travelers should monitor local event schedules as parking patterns can shift during large tournaments or club functions.

Navigating the area is most efficient with a personal vehicle or a rental car, as public transit is limited in this specific pocket of the Harrisburg suburbs. Rideshare services are available throughout the city, though availability can be more sporadic near the club grounds compared to the downtown core. For a smooth arrival, plan to reach the facility at least thirty minutes prior to your scheduled activity to allow time for gear transport and check-in procedures. If you are traveling as part of a larger group or team, coordinate your caravan timing to ensure everyone can park together efficiently.

State Museum of Pennsylvania

5.5 mi

Located in the heart of Harrisburg, this museum provides a comprehensive look at the history, culture, and natural environment of the state. It features multiple floors of exhibits, including a planetarium and an impressive collection of geological artifacts. The museum is an excellent option for groups looking to learn something new during their downtime. It is easily accessible by car and offers plenty of space for families and teams to explore at their own pace.

Fort Hunter Mansion and Park

4.2 mi

This historic site along the Susquehanna River offers beautiful grounds for walking and picnicking, along with guided tours of the 19th-century mansion. The park provides a serene escape from the city and is a favorite spot for those who enjoy local history and river views. It is a relatively quick drive from the sportsman club, making it a convenient stop for a relaxing afternoon. The park is especially vibrant during the spring and autumn seasons.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winters in Harrisburg are cold, with temperatures frequently dropping below freezing. Visitors should pack heavy coats, hats, and gloves, especially since the club is primarily an outdoor facility. Snow and ice can impact travel times on secondary roads, so check the forecast before your trip.

🌱

Spring & early summer

This period brings mild temperatures and beautiful blooming landscapes, making it an ideal time for outdoor sports. It can be quite rainy, so bringing waterproof gear and layers is a wise strategy. The weather is generally comfortable for long days spent outside at the club.

☀️

Mid-summer

Summer months are characterized by hot and humid conditions, often reaching into the high 80s or 90s. Staying hydrated is critical when spending extended time on the range or fields. Pack light, breathable clothing and plenty of sunscreen for your time outdoors.

🍂

Fall season

Autumn is widely considered the best time to visit, with crisp, cool air and stunning fall foliage. Temperatures are perfect for outdoor activities, though you may want a light jacket for the cooler mornings and evenings. It is a comfortable and highly recommended time for travel.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ain can occur at any time of year, while snow is primarily a factor from December through March. Always check local weather alerts, as heavy storms can affect event schedules or road safety. Having a flexible itinerary that includes indoor backups is always a good idea.
